Web-based tools

Web-based tools are the friends of those who dislike the Terminal, way of communication with the Grid and so Linux-related.

What follows are the available -so far- plateforms. In addition to their adresses, for the most curious are informations About them but for the others, who just want to know Howto use them are given "Step-by-step" articles.

This Wiki - Information board About
OpenAtrium - A Project Manager for Usergroups, tasks and logistics management About Howto
Galaxy - A computational biology research platform About Howto
Cytomine - A collaborative imaging analysis platform About Howto
RStudio - A web IDE for R About Howto
GitLab - A versioning platform About Howto
